Why Do TRICARE Beneficiaries Miss Medical Appointments?

Breanna Wakar, Amy Gehrke and Nancy Clusen

Mathematica Policy Research Reports from Mathematica Policy Research

Abstract: This brief describes changes in the prevalence of and reasons for missed, canceled, and rescheduled appointments with military or civilian providers between 2013 and 2018.
